2006年10月23日

メモリー常駐表

表やインデックスを共有メモリー上に常駐させることはできないのかな~、と思い調べてみました。

すると、SET TABLE 文 ( または SET INDEX 文 ) で出来るらしいことがわかりました。

ところが、Dynamic Server v10 のマニュアル ( SQL 文法 ) を良く読むと、v9.40 でこの機能はなくなってしまったらしいです。実行すると、それらしいメッセージが出るので、安心していたのですが、マニュアルによると、内部では無視されているらしいです。Informix XPS では使用できるらしいのですが、残念です。

更に調べてみると、Version 9 系では v9.30 で初めてこの機能が入った模様。短命な機能だったようです。

こんなメッセージが出るから期待してたのに。。。

C:\Program Files\IBM\Informix>dbaccess stores_demo -

データベースが選択されました。

> SET TABLE customer MEMORY_RESIDENT;

メモリ常駐ステータスが変更されました。

>


タグ :ids

同じカテゴリー(IBM Webサイトにある情報)の記事
JDBC driver
JDBC driver(2022-04-17 15:24)

Informix V12.10.xC6
Informix V12.10.xC6(2016-01-20 23:14)

Informix V12.10.xC5
Informix V12.10.xC5(2015-03-30 22:39)

OpenAdminTool ( OAT) V3.14
OpenAdminTool ( OAT) V3.14(2014-06-28 14:17)


※このブログではブログの持ち主が承認した後、コメントが反映される設定です。
上の画像に書かれている文字を入力して下さい
 
<ご注意>
書き込まれた内容は公開され、ブログの持ち主だけが削除できます。